'''Special 2-2''' is the second level of [[Special 2]] in ''[[Super Mario 3D Land]]''. It is based on [[World 3-2 (Super Mario 3D Land)|World 3-2]].

The player starts out on a beach right in front of the water with a [[+ Clock]] in the water. Underwater, are two more + Clocks and two [[Blooper]]s right next to the [[Warp Pipe]].

The player will exit the Warp Pipe on another beach area and can can either go underwater immediately or jump onto a platform which has a [[Spiky Plant]] before going underwater again. Progressing through the water the player will find an abyss with more water to the right of it, progressing through this will lead the player to Rubber Platform which will get the player to surface, before they go underwater again. The next underwater area contains several Bloopers and a [[Spike Eel]]. After progressing through that area, the player will use another Rubber Platform to surface again and then they will enter the Warp Pipe that leads to the final area. The final area has a bridge that leads straight to the [[Goal Pole]].
